Re: When telnet the output is mono-chrome and vi
editor does not work properly
I have installed telnetd
(telnet-server-0.17-23.i386.rpm) on Red Hat Linux 7.2
running on Intel Pentium III PC server.
When I telnet from another PC, I don�t see colors and
the output is just mono-chrome. The values of the
$TERM and the $_ are �dumb�. The output of the vi
editor is messy.
When I ssh, it works fine and can see colors and can
use the vi editor and the values of the $TERM and the
$_ are �xterm�.
I have installed the same telnetd server on another PC
server but running Red Hat Linux 7.1 and when I telnet
to this server, I can see colors and values of the
$TERM and the $_ are �xterm�.
The /etc/DIR_COLORS is the same on both machines.
Contenets of the /etc/xinetd.d/telnet is same on both
servers and is as follows:
service telnet
{
flags = REUSE
socket_type = stream
wait = no
user = root
server = /usr/sbin/in.telnetd
log_on_failure += USERID
disable = no
}
Could somebody please explain to me how to fix this
problem?
